Vivekananda College review for B.Com (Hons).
Placements: My college placement for B.Com (hons) is very limited. There are no proper placement opportunities, and reputed companies rarely visit. Few that come are mostly for sales roles, like Bajaj Allianz and HDFC Life, which don't match the career expectations of most students. Placements are limited, mostly sales roles, so higher studies or external opportunities are better.
Infrastructure: At Vivekananda College, Thakurpukur has decent infrastructure with spacious classrooms, a library, computer labs, and a large playground. However, facilities are quite basic, and maintenance could be better. Campus environment is peaceful but lacks modern amenities found in top colleges.
Faculty: Teachers in B.Com (Hons) CBCS are helpful but the way of teaching differs from one to another. The syllabus is wide but not very practical. Exams happen on time, though most papers test memory more than real understanding, so it does not feel fully useful for future jobs.
Other: At Vivekananda College, Thakurpukur is good for B.Com (hons) with decent faculty members, peaceful campus, and supportive environment. A good choice if you want affordable education with a calm atmosphere.

Review of Vivekananda College, Kolkata.
Placements: Frankly speaking, the placement cell of the college is very inefficient. Every year only a couple of student gets a placement with a package more or less Rs 8,000 to Rs 10,000 per month. However, there is a concept of Summer Internship conducted every even-semester. As per the Calcutta University guidelines, one student has to complete at least one such internship to get a graduation certificate.
Infrastructure: College infrastructure is more or less good. The classrooms are large and each of them can accommodate 100-150 students. College canteen offers healthy and tasty food at affordable prices. There is a gymnasium and an indoor games room for the students. There are also facilities like drinking water, free Wi-Fi, science laboratory, and library on the campus. Unfortunately, there is no hostel facility provided by the college. But one can get a good PG in the nearby locality.
Faculty: College faculty members are very well qualified and helpful to the students. The college comes under the jurisdiction of Calcutta University and therefore follows the curriculum set by it. The semester-end examinations are conducted every 6 months by CU. For passing, each student has to get 30% of the marks in each paper.

The infrastructure and facilities are good.
Placements: Placement interviews are organised by the placement cell of the college. Many students from the previous year batch and even passed out students got placed in renowned companies last year. Many students of our senior batches were offered internship opportunities from the college. The placement cell is well organised and works much efficiently. In the last couple of years, many renowned companies like Cognizant, Wipro, Tata Consultancy Services, ITC, HCL, and Dabur, etc., have conducted placement drives in our college.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ure of the campus includes a college library, a stationery store, common room, canteen, cycle/bike stand, playground, gymnasium, yoga centre, book bank for poor sections, student's union, cultural cell, training and a placement cell, women's cell and laboratories. Free Wi-Fi facility is provided throughout the campus. The library has a wide range of books, journals and magazines, and there are a total of more than 40,000 books and other magazines available. There are separate common rooms for boys and girls. The common rooms are well managed by the student's union. The student's union consists of items for recreational activities of students. The canteen provides hygienic food at subsidised rates.
Faculty: The teachers are well qualified, knowledgeable and much supportive. The quality of teaching is also pretty good. Students are being exposed to industries wherever required. Teaching methods used are generally old fashioned, but modern techniques are adopted whenever possible.
Other: Every year, the inter-department sports competition is organised in the winter season, which includes games like football and cricket. Every year, before the festival of Durga Puja, freshers party is organised by the students union and the college authority. Extracurricular activities such as NSS and NCC programmes are carried throughout the year. Cultural programs are also organised by the student's union.
